Storm window replacement services involve removing old or damaged storm windows and installing new units to improve a building’s exterior protection. The process typically includes assessing the existing windows, selecting appropriate replacement options, and properly installing the new storm windows to ensure a secure fit. This service helps enhance the insulation properties of a property, reduce drafts, and improve overall energy efficiency by preventing air leaks around the windows.
One of the primary issues storm window replacement addresses is air infiltration, which can lead to increased heating and cooling costs. Damaged or outdated storm windows may also allow moisture and water intrusion, potentially causing issues like mold or wood rot. Replacing storm windows can help maintain the integrity of the building envelope, protect interior spaces from the elements, and extend the lifespan of the primary windows by providing an additional barrier against weather-related wear.

The overview below groups typical Storm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mechanicsburg, PA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- Storm window replacement typically costs between $300 and $800 per window, depending on size and material. For example, a standard double-hung window might fall within this range, with larger or custom designs costing more.
Material Factors - The choice of material, such as vinyl, aluminum, or wood, influences the overall cost. Vinyl options tend to be more affordable, while wood storm windows may be at the higher end of the price spectrum.
Labor Expenses - Installation costs can vary from $100 to $300 per window, influenced by the complexity of removal and fitting. Local pros may charge more for custom or difficult-to-access installations.
Additional Costs - Costs may increase if additional work is needed, such as frame repairs or insulation, which can add several hundred dollars to the overall expense. Budgeting for these extras helps ensure a comprehensive project estimate.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m windows? Storm windows are secondary windows installed on the exterior or interior of existing windows to improve insulation and protection against the elements.
How often should storm windows be replaced? Replacement frequency depends on the condition and age of the existing storm windows; a professional can assess whether new ones are needed.
What materials are used for storm window replacements? Common materials include aluminum, vinyl, and wood, chosen based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
Can storm window replacement improve energy efficiency? Yes, installing new storm windows can help reduce heat loss and improve overall energy efficiency in a home.
